Re: URGENT request from the Murray River boys
I was under the asumpion that 2 days of running and then change the gear case oil. It looks like they are doing 8 to 10 hours a day and seagulls are supposed to have the gear case oil changed every 10hrs. If its like a iced coffee appearance. It's fine.
